Apportionment to the
Kern County Office of Education
for Mental Health and Wellness Resources Fiscal Year 2021–22

This apportionment, in the amount of $25,000,000, is made to the Kern County Office of Education (COE) from funds provided in Assembly Bill (AB) 130, Chapter 44, Statutes of 2021, as amended by AB 167, Chapter 252, Statutes of 2021, and equals 100 percent of the amount available. These funds are for the Kern COE to contract with the Child Mind Institute for purposes of developing mental health and wellness instructional resources and trainings for caregivers, educators, and youth to address impacts of the COVID-19 pandemic on children’s mental health and to promote mental wellness within families and school communities.

Of the funds provided, $10,000,000 is for the production and development of a series of instructional training videos, print resources, and toolkits for caregivers, youth, and educators that cover youth mental health and wellness skill sets. The remaining $15,000,000 is for direct compensation to educators for their participation in the completion of the instructional training video series.

A warrant will be mailed to the Kern County Treasurer approximately three to four weeks from the date of this notice. For standardized account code structure coding, use Resource Code 7810, Mental Health and Wellness Resources, and Revenue Object Code 8590, All Other State Revenue.
